# Menú "Diagrama"

El menú “Diagrama” contiene botones para las acciones necesarias al construir un diagrama del Robot.

<figure><img src="https://3940823687-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F8QfFNyYLPzoIrRZpZokA%2Fuploads%2Fgit-blob-c9528432ca86b1abc20afede2e3b7146ea687e9c%2Fimage%20(252).png?alt=media" alt=""><figcaption></figcaption></figure>

A continuación se presenta una lista de estos botones con la descripción de sus funciones.

<table data-header-hidden><thead><tr><th width="60.86669921875"></th><th width="255.7166748046875"></th><th width="310.449951171875"></th></tr></thead><tbody><tr><td><strong>N°</strong></td><td><strong>Elemento de interfaz</strong></td><td><strong>Descripción</strong></td></tr><tr><td><ol><li></li></ol></td><td>botón “Alinear”</td><td>Permite alinear los bloques seleccionados según una regla dada.</td></tr><tr><td><ol start="2"><li></li></ol></td><td>botón “Ubicación”</td><td>Permite cambiar el orden de los bloques que se cruzan.</td></tr><tr><td><ol start="3"><li></li></ol></td><td>botón “Verificación completa de bloques”</td><td>Permite realizar una verificación completa de las propiedades de los bloques.</td></tr><tr><td><ol start="4"><li></li></ol></td><td>botón “Eliminar variables no utilizadas”</td><td>Permite encontrar y eliminar variables no utilizadas.</td></tr><tr><td><ol start="5"><li></li></ol></td><td>botón “Compilar bloques de llamada de código”</td><td>Permite compilar todos los bloques de llamada de código en el proyecto. Esta acción acelera el funcionamiento de estos bloques.</td></tr><tr><td><ol start="6"><li></li></ol></td><td>botón “Agrupar”</td><td>Permite agrupar los bloques seleccionados para moverlos como una sola unidad.</td></tr><tr><td><ol start="7"><li></li></ol></td><td>botón “Desagrupar”</td><td>Permite desagrupar los bloques que fueron agrupados anteriormente.</td></tr></tbody></table>

El botón “**Alinear**” en el menú de herramientas permite alinear los bloques seleccionados según una regla dada. Para seleccionar la opción deseada, es necesario hacer clic en el ícono ![](https://3940823687-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F8QfFNyYLPzoIrRZpZokA%2Fuploads%2Fgit-blob-76f09ba00c8837a30738a902d3e57a272bcab98d%2F2025-07-04_00-42-18%20\(1\).png?alt=media) debajo del botón “Alinear”.

<figure><img src="https://3940823687-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F8QfFNyYLPzoIrRZpZokA%2Fuploads%2Fgit-blob-b73f70f17df701b68820bd690081e9a967740ecc%2F2025-11-20_21-16-26.png?alt=media" alt=""><figcaption></figcaption></figure>

El botón “**Ubicación**” en el menú de herramientas permite cambiar el orden de los bloques que se cruzan. Para seleccionar la opción deseada, es necesario hacer clic en el ícono ![](https://3940823687-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F8QfFNyYLPzoIrRZpZokA%2Fuploads%2Fgit-blob-76f09ba00c8837a30738a902d3e57a272bcab98d%2F2025-07-04_00-42-18%20\(1\).png?alt=media) debajo del botón “Ubicación”.

<figure><img src="https://3940823687-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F8QfFNyYLPzoIrRZpZokA%2Fuploads%2Fgit-blob-33ff0d638c8c0e9ae6d5daaf52dbe7fd93725c34%2Fimage%20(253).png?alt=media" alt=""><figcaption></figcaption></figure>

La autoorganización de bloques se demuestra en el siguiente video:

{% embed url="<https://sherparpa.ru/ucontent/?0D>" %}

La autoorganización de bloques en el ejemplo de un gran proyecto con una estructura compleja:

{% embed url="<https://sherparpa.ru/ucontent/?QhZl>" %}


---

# Agent Instructions: Querying This Documentation

If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://docs.sherparpa.ru/es/sherpa-rpa/sherpa-designer/rabota-v-sherpa-designer/osnovnoe-menyu/panel-instrumenty/menyu-diagramma.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
